Port Talbot Parkway provides a wide array of facilities to ensure a comfortable journey. The ticket office is open daily with extended hours, from early morning until evening, making it convenient for travelers to purchase and collect tickets. For an extra touch of accessibility, ticket machines are available to collect tickets bought online. Although smartcard issuance isn't available, travelers can rest assured knowing that induction loops are in place for those with hearing impairments.
In terms of accessibility, the station is category A with step-free access throughout. This includes a footbridge with lifts to ensure that all passengers can navigate the station with ease. Accessible toilets, baby changing facilities, and waiting rooms are all part of the accessible amenities. Plus, the Work of Art café offers a charming spot to relax with a hot drink while you wait for your train. While you're at it, you can follow the café on Instagram for updates and delightful visuals.
Port Talbot Parkway doesn't just stop at train travel; it connects you to various local transport services. For those times when a train isn't an option, the station's south car park hosts a rail replacement bus stop. If you prefer to explore Port Talbot by bus, consider purchasing a PlusBus ticket for unlimited travel throughout the town. Visit PlusBus.info for more information.
For riders who prefer taxis, the station features a convenient taxi rank right at the front. However, if cycling is more your pace, although bicycle hire isn't available, there are several secure bicycle racks at the station for those who travel by bike.

At Charing Station, simplicity is key while attending to essential needs. Ticket purchasing is made straightforward, with a ticket office open from 07:15 to 11:40 on weekdays, supplemented by accessible ticket machines for those quick buys on the go. Smartcards are issued here, though don't expect the convenience of validators, adding a note of traditionalism to your journey.
For those needing a little extra assistance, the station provides help points, CCTV for added security, and staff presence during morning hours on weekdays. Step-free access is available primarily for services away from London, but travelers should take heed of the footbridge which offers access to other platforms without step-free options. Unfortunately, amenities like refreshment facilities, shops, and an ATM are absent, so arrive prepared.
Located in the rustic heart of Kent, Charing (Kent) Station links travelers with various transport modes. Rail replacement bus services conveniently operate from the station car park, providing alternate routes when rails are under maintenance. Travelers can also download a comprehensive onward travel map here to plan their journey seamlessly. While taxis aren't stationed outside, the area is well-connected with nearby bus services to ensure you're never stranded.
